Transaction 2328821ce2e21740cfae50689c0c50f4b0095ece54dadc9302c002181eb27e27
1 Input
1 Output
-
2328821ce2e21740cfae50689c0c50f4b0095ece54dadc9302c002181eb27e27:0
- value
- 1395112
- script pubkey
- OP_0 OP_PUSHBYTES_20 99e89a02202f12f097d1131eed4d84566a0e0f8d
- address
- bc1qn85f5q3q9uf0p973zv0w6nvy2e4qurudg03djd